  • For those who arrive to Iceland before the tour starts:

    When you arrive at Keflavík International Airport you are only 45 minutes away from Reykjavik City Center.

    Your options from KEF Airport to Reykjavik;

    Most recommend: Shuttle Bus (FlyBus) $35-60 This will take you directly to your hotel.

    Private Taxi: A taxi from Keflavik airport to Reykjavik can be quite expensive. The price is calculated by a taximeter and can be upwards of (154 euros/171 US dollars).

Day 1

PICKUPS

On your first morning, you will be picked up from the airport or hotel and start your way immediately along the Southern Coast. Our accommodation is on the other side of the island and requires almost two hours of driving, but we will make many stops at different locations to break up the journey.

The first two stops are the waterfalls Seljalandsfoss and Skógafoss. Seljalandsfoss has a path behind it that allows you to adventure behind the falls. Skógafoss is a wide and roaring waterfall with chances of rainbows :) 

Next, we will visit another stunning waterfall nearby. Hidden in a canyon of rocky mountains.

Next, we will be heading to the last location of the day: The famous Black Sand Beach Reynisfjara.

Day 2

VIK TO VATNAJOKULL NATIONAL PARK

We start the day driving from Vík to Vatnajokull National Park to start exploring the glacial area. We'll spend most of our day at the National Park doing small hikes and wandering around the face of the Glacier. We’ll visit a waterfall and see a glacier close up.

Next, we will be visiting The glacier lagoon known as Jökulsárlón. It’s a lagoon filled with drifting ICE chunks and hearing the ice drift and crack is an ethereal experience. 

From Jökulsárlón we head over to a beach only a minute away. This beach is no ordinary beach. The black sand beach right off of Jökulsárlón is where a lot of the ice chunks drift and land. It’s also known as Iceland’s Black Diamond Beach.

Day 4

 Eglisstadir to Myvatn

We start our day driving to the Geothermal areas of Myvatn. Be prepared to be amazed by the Mars-like scenery and terrain.

Visiting HVERIR. Hverir is a fascinating area comparable to walking on the moon or mars. There are burping mud pools, hot vents, and the interesting smell of sulfur.

Next, Climb HAVERFELL Crater. HAVERFELL Crater is an easy hike and climb up to the top. This crater was formed via a massive explosion 2,700 years ago. 

Next, we drive to and visit Goðafoss! Named “ Waterfall Of The Gods”. One of the most scenic waterfalls in Iceland.

Tours are always dependent on weather, as Icelandic weather can be highly unpredictable.

Northern Lights are highly unpredictable. But with an experienced guide, you will have a higher chance of seeing them.

You will only get a chance to see the northern lights if you come at the right time of the year. Northern Lights season is from September to early April.

During the summer season, there are no northern lights. Tours from May-August are considered summer tours that have no chance of the Northern Lights.

So if you’d like to see the northern lights, book travel dates during the northern lights season.
